Amends the Controlled Substances Act and part A (General Provisions) of title XI of the Social Security Act to authorize the Attorney General to suspend or revoke a registration to manufacture, distribute, or dispense a controlled substance upon a finding that the registrant has been excluded from participation under title XVIII (Medicare) of the Social Security Act.
